Chill while you Grill
The siding of a house is damaged by a grill fire. From 2005 to 2009, fire departments in the United States responded to over 8,200 home fires involving grills that resulted in a total of 15 deaths, 120 injuries, and more than $75 million in property damage. (U.S. Air Force courtesy photo)

Volunteer Excellence Awards
Service members and civilians are recognized April 20, 2012, at the Air Mobility Command Museum at Dover Air Force Base, Del., for outstanding service to Dover AFB and the local community. Col. James Mercer, 436th Airlift Wing vice wing commander, presented 31 volunteers with certificates and medals during the 2012 Volunteer Excellence Award Ceremony. The winners in this year’s Volunteer Excellence Award category for longevity were Perry Bratcher, Kimberly Landis and Bobby Bible. The Angel Award winners were Sandy Roddy, Kathy McNulty, Joyce Ford, Staff Sgt. Deondra Braden, Tina Veves and Quinneisha Brooks. (U.S. Air Force photo by Roland Balik)

Toastmasters
Tech. Sgt. Ronelo Navarro, 436th Maintenance Squadron, gives an impromptu speech during the Toastmasters International table topics session April 25, 2012, at Dover Air Force Base, Del. Members of the “Dover Air Power” Toastmasters Club attended the meeting, seeking to improve their leadership and communication skills. (U.S. Air Force photo by Roland Balik)
